在聊技术之前,咱们先来看看加密货币钱包的基本概念。简单来说,加密货币钱包就是一个存放你数字资产的地方,就像是你口袋里的钱包。不过,这个钱包是虚拟的,里面装的可不仅仅是钞票,还有比特币、以太坊等各种数字货币。
钱包的核心功能,就是让你能安全地存储、发送和接收加密货币。这东西其实就类似于我们平常用的银行账户,但加密货币钱包更为私密,你的资产不再受银行的控制,而是掌握在你自己手中。
好,接下来咱们说说,构建一个加密货币钱包需要什么样的技术。这玩意儿可不是随便哪个小程序就能做出来的,背后得有不少技术支撑呢。
首先,我们得提到区块链技术。它是加密货币的基础,钱包的所有交易信息都是在区块链上进行存储和处理的。区块链就像一个公共账本,人人都能查到,而你在这个账本上的每一笔交易都是透明且不可更改的。
想想看,如果没有区块链,咱们就没办法确认每一笔交易的真实性,钱包里的数字货币可能会被“复制”或伪造,那可就麻烦了。
再来一块,就是密钥的管理。每个加密货币钱包都有一对密钥:公钥和私钥。公钥就像是你在银行的账户号码,可以公开给别人用来给你转账;而私钥就像是你银行账户的密码,绝对不能外泄!
技术上讲,钱包需要一个安全的方式来生成和保存这些密钥。如果私钥泄露,黑客就能轻易地转走你钱包里的全部资产,所以安全性是重中之重。
现在的市面上有不少种类的钱包,常见的有热钱包和冷钱包。热钱包就是常在线的,比如手机APP或网页钱包,方便用户随时充值和消费;冷钱包则是离线的,比如硬件钱包,不常连网,安全性更高。
其实,选择哪种钱包,主要还是看你的使用习惯和对安全的需求。有的人丝毫不在乎,只用热钱包;有人则特别谨慎,宁可麻烦也要用冷钱包保存大额资产。
上面提到过,安全是个大问题。钱包在设计时,得考虑到各种潜在的风险。想想看,许多人可能会因为使用不当或不够谨慎,而丢失一大笔钱。所以,设计钱包时得引入一些安全保障措施。
使用二次验证(2FA)是一种常见的安全措施,比如用手机短信验证码确认交易。这就像在你家门口加了一把锁,再加个指纹识别,保险得多。
可以提供备份功能也是必要的,因为有时候手机丢了,或者电脑坏了,我们得有办法找回钱包里的资产。一般来说,备份会生成一组助记词,用户可以把它们写下来,存放在安全的地方。
说到这里,想跟大家分享一个小故事。几年前,我也是刚入门加密货币的时候,懵懵懂懂把所有的资金都放在一个热钱包里,后来竟然被黑客攻击了,钱包里的钱瞬间蒸发。那时候心里可真是太揪心了,后悔得要命。
现在想来,还是得好好布局,热钱包应付日常的小额交易就好,大额资金一定要放在安全的冷钱包里。用冷钱包的时候,虽然每次取款都得麻烦一下,但安全感上来了,心里就踏实多了。
其实,加密货币钱包的技术实现并不复杂,但里面涉及的东西可多着呢。从区块链基础到密钥管理、不同种类的钱包,再到安全保障措施,每一个环节都得用心去做。对于普通用户来说,懂得一点基本的知识,就能在这个市场里走得更稳妥。
就是这样,聊了这么多,如果你对加密货币钱包还有更多的疑问,欢迎随时问我哦!咱们一起探讨,找到最适合自己的加密货币管理方式!